The B thermostat terminal is used on for Rheem or Ruud and any manufacturer that energizes the reversing valve in heating mode for the heat pump. O or B - These thermostat terminals are for heat pumps. There is no universal color used for this terminal although black is often used. Many digital thermostats require 24 volts for power so the common wire is necessary. On a split system the blower fan is in the air handler while with a package unit the blower fan is in the outdoor package unit.Ĭ (common) - This is the thermostat terminal which originates from the transformer and is necessary to complete the 24 volts power circuit in the thermostat but only if the thermostat consumes electricity for power. G - This is the thermostat terminal used for the fan relay to energize the indoor blower fan. Heat Pumps use staging for auxiliary heat and need a W2 terminal. There are gas furnaces with low fire and high fire and some depend on control from a two-stage heating thermostat with a W2 terminal.

W2 - This is the thermostat terminal used for second stage heat.

This wire should go directly to the heating source whether it be a gas or oil furnace, electric furnace, or boiler. W - This is the thermostat terminal for heating. Many systems only have a single compressor but if you have two compressors which should only operate off of one thermostat then you need the Y2 thermostat terminal for second stage cooling. Y2 - This is the thermostat terminal for cooling second stage if your system is so equipped. Some manufacturers put a terminal board strip near the control board in the air handler so a splice is not needed. Typically a thermostat wire pull is made to the air handler on split systems and then this wire is spliced for the separate wire pull which is made to the condenser. Y - This is the terminal for cooling or air conditioning and goes to the compressor relay. It should be noted that a jumper can be installed between RC and RH for a heating and cooling system equipped with a single transformer. RH - The RH terminal is designated for the power for heating. In this case the power from the transformer in the air conditioning system would go to the thermostat terminal. A transformer for cooling and a transformer for heating. RC - The RC terminal is designated for the power for cooling. If you have a package unit then the transformer is in the package unit. For this reason, it is a good idea to kill the power at the condenser and the air handler before changing or working on the wiring at the thermostat. This comes from the transformer usually located in the air handler for split systems but you may find the transformer in the condensing unit. R - The R terminal is the power for the thermostat.
